One of the key benefits of roof lanterns with opening windows is their ability to regulate the indoor temperature. During hot summer days, opening the windows in the roof lantern can help to reduce heat build-up by allowing hot air to escape, creating a cooling breeze throughout the space. In the winter, the windows can be closed to retain warmth and create a cozy environment. This flexibility in temperature control makes roof lanterns with opening windows an ideal choice for year-round comfort.
